How much do distributor sales development man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average yearly pay for distributor sales development manager in Seattle, WA is $88,021.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$66,600.00 and $105,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a distributor sales development manager?

A Distributor Sales Development Manager is responsible for building and managing relationships with distribution partners to drive sales growth and achieve revenue targets. They identify opportunities for expanding product reach, coordinate sales strategies, and provide training and support to distributor teams. Their role often involves analyzing sales data, setting performance goals, and collaborating with internal and external stakeholders to maximize market potential. This position is key in ensuring that products are effectively represented and sold through distributor channels.

How does a distributor sales development manager typically collaborate with distributor partners to drive sales growth?

A Distributor Sales Development Manager works closely with distributor partners by providing training, sharing market intelligence, and co-developing sales strategies tailored to local markets. They often conduct joint sales calls, coordinate promotional events, and analyze sales performance data to identify growth opportunities. Regular communication and relationship-building are key, as the manager must ensure alignment on goals, resolve conflicts, and support distributors in achieving sales targets. Collaborating cross-functionally with marketing, logistics, and product teams is also common to ensure distributors have the resources and support needed for success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a distributor sales development man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Distributor Sales Development Manager, you need a strong background in sales strategy, account management, and distribution channel development,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Proficiency with CRM software, sales analytics tools, and inventory management systems is commonly required. Exceptional relationship-building, negotiation, and communication skills help dist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are crucial for driving sales growth, optimizing distributor partnerships, and achieving revenue targets in competitive markets.

What is the difference between Distributor Sales Development Manager vs Sales Representative?

AspectDistributor Sales Development ManagerSales Representative
Primary RoleDevelops distributor channels, builds relationships, and drives sales growth through distributorsDirectly sells products to end customers or clients
Work EnvironmentCorporate, B2B, distributor networksRetail, B2C, direct customer interactions
Required CredentialsTypically a bachelor's degree, sales experience, industry knowledgeHigh school diploma or equivalent, sales skills, industry familiarity
Industry UsageCommon in manufacturing, wholesale, and distribution sectorsWidespread across retail, wholesale, and service industries

The Distributor Sales Development Manager focuses on developing distributor relationships and expanding sales channels, whereas the Sales Representative directly engages with end customers to sell products. Both roles require sales skills and industry knowledge but differ in target audience and scope.

Is a Distributor Sales Development Manager an entry level position?

A Distributor Sales Development Manager is typically a mid- to senior-level role that requires prior sales experience, industry knowledge, and strong communication skills. It is generally not considered an entry-level position, as it involves managing distributor relationships and developing sales strategies. Candidates often need relevant experience and sometimes certifications in sales or management.

Is being a distributor sales development manager a stressful job?

A distributor sales development manager role can be stressful due to targets, client management, and coordinating with multiple teams. The job often requires strong communication skills, time management, and the ability to handle pressure, especially during peak sales periods or when meeting quotas.

About Omni CleanAir

At Omni CleanAir, we are dedicated to protecting people by improving the air they breathe. For more than 30 years, we have designed and manufactured advanced air purification solutions used in mission-critical environments worldwide - including healthcare, construction, manufacturing, and emergency response.


Our commercial-grade technologies remove hazardous airborne particles to help create safer workplaces and healthier communities. Trusted by professionals across industries, Omni CleanAir is committed to delivering reliable solutions when air quality matters most.
